Why We're Designing Extraterrestrial Base Safety Gear Completely Wrong by obaban in IsaacArthur

[–]Ap0theon 75 points76 points  (0 children)

The expanse books(and the tv show to an extent) do this well, whenever there's a good change you'll end up with a big hole in the spaceship(combat, debris field, etc) you pump all the air out and wear a suit with an umbilical to the ship. Solves the rushing for a suit problem and the explosive decompression problem. Another thing to consider with permanent structures vs the ISS is that anything built for permanent industrial use will be a lot more sturdy than our current scientific stations and therefore more likely to end up with a slow leak than a rupture
